Handcrafted from reeds, grasses, bamboo, and natural woods, woven wood window shades are uniquely textured and provide a striking combination of natural beauty and function. Woven window shades are created using natural woods and fibers that are custom woven into a Roman-style shade. When raised, the folds of a woven wood shade form the pleated accordion look of a classic roman shade.
